Output 20d33a31a62486434f3df68c26fd86715e78c1e188cd786220a9b19b62de2057:0

value
177891798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7d13dbb00a987d804944acd4ffdbcd7b0d315ff OP_EQUAL
address
3JSxEyf1UJmHBahL3uBp8b2PnKJE6ThAeV
transaction
20d33a31a62486434f3df68c26fd86715e78c1e188cd786220a9b19b62de2057
spent
true